The Freunde und Förderer der Hochschule für Musik und Theater Rostock e.V. (Society of Friends and Supporters of the Rostock University of Music and Drama) help students to take part in competitions around the world, fund PhD research and artistic projects, organise guest lectures, and provide support and assistance with the purchase of instruments.

We provide support where state funding ends, thereby making so much possible. We also make our wide-ranging contacts available to the University. We select our funding projects carefully in consultation with the University management.

Funding example: Guitar class on concert tour

With the support of the Friends of the hmt Rostock, we guitarists will once again be able to go on a concert tour this year. In May, we will be performing Steve Reich's "Electric Point" for 12 guitars, 2 basses and solo guitar with a large ensemble in Berlin and Bonn. We will also be joined by 3 alumni. This would not have been possible without the generous support of the Förderverein. Last year we were able to perform at the major guitar festival in Mikulov/Czech Republic, where we were able to perform Marek Pasieczny's "Ex Nihilo" for 12 guitars and 2 soloists with great success. We are very grateful to the Förderverein for this!

Prof Dr Thomas Offermann, Head of Studies

‘Music is a multicultural means and a platform for getting to know new people and experiencing new and remarkable moments in life. Music teaches us more than just music. Music can take us to many different places all over the globe. That’s what happened to me last year in Switzerland. I received the opportunity to work together with the world’s best brass players and instructors Their names are Ian Bousfield (former member of the Vienna Philharmonic), Rex Martin (Northwestern University, USA) and Thomas Rüedi (Bern University of the Arts). It was a week in which I hugely profited from the knowledge of these three masters and it was only possible due to the financial support of hmt Rostock’s Society of Supporters and Friends. Without this aid, I probably would have missed out on one of the most influential moments of my life.’

Nuno Henriques, Master of Music Trombone
